Broadcaster stops IND vs PAK women's cricket match midway to telecast FIFA World Cup, fans get furious
India began their ICC Women’s T20 World Cup 2026 campaign in dominant fashion with a comprehensive 64-run victory over Pakistan at Edgbaston, Birmingham, on Sunday, June 14. However, while the action unfolded on the field, a separate controversy reportedly emerged off it, leaving several Pakistani viewers frustrated.
According to reports, Pakistan's official cricket broadcaster allegedly switched its live coverage from the high-profile India-Pakistan Women’s T20 World Cup clash to a FIFA World Cup 2026 match featuring Germany and Curacao during Pakistan’s run chase that looked inevitable. The move sparked criticism among fans, with many taking to social media to express their disappointment.
A video featuring Pakistani YouTuber Furqan Bhati reacting to the reported broadcast change has since gone viral. In the clip, Bhati questioned the broadcaster’s decision to move away from one of the biggest cricket rivalries in the world.
“What’s going on? Pakistan versus India is being played there, and they’re showing a FIFA World Cup match. Germany is playing? Is Germany in Punjab? Is it in Sindh, Balochistan, or Khyber Pakhtunkhwa? Where exactly is Germany?” Bhati said in the video.

Earlier in the match, India posted an imposing total of 170/6 after being asked to bat first. Star opener Smriti Mandhana led the charge with a fluent 68 off 44 deliveries, while skipper Harmanpreet Kaur added a valuable 36 runs.
Wicketkeeper-batter Richa Ghosh provided the finishing touches with a blistering 34 off just 17 balls, helping India collect 38 runs in the final two overs and push the total beyond Pakistan’s reach.
In response, Pakistan struggled to build momentum and were eventually bowled out for 106 in 17 overs. Deepti Sharma starred with the ball, registering remarkable figures of 5/10 in four overs, the best bowling figures by an Indian woman in T20 International cricket. She also effected a direct-hit run-out to further dent Pakistan’s hopes.

Tournament debutant Shree Charani chipped in with two wickets as India sealed a convincing win to start their World Cup campaign on a high.
India will next face the Netherlands at Old Trafford on June 17 as they look to continue their winning momentum. Pakistan, meanwhile, will aim for a quick turnaround when they take on South Africa in Birmingham on the same day.
